Written by product experts and trainers who have produced many of Adobe's training titles, Dynamic Learning: Flash CS3 Professional is organized into lessons, with easy-to-follow instructions and a Digital Classroom DVD with video tutorials and all of the graphics files needed for the lessons. Covers what's new in Flash CS3, using the drawing tools, modifying graphics, working with symbols and the library, getting started with ActionScript, and more.
Full Description
This full-color book is organized into lessons, with easy-to-follow instructions, tips, examples, and review questions at the end of every lesson. Each lesson is self-contained, so you can go through the entire book sequentially or just focus on individual lessons.
Topics covered include:
- What's new in Flash CS3 Professional
- Flash CS3 jumpstart
- Drawing tools
- Modifying and transforming graphics
- Working with symbols and the library
- ActionScript
- Working with video and audio
